What Is Cold Laser Treatment?



Cold laser treatment, additionally called low-level laser treatment (LLLT), is a non-invasive treatment that utilizes certain wavelengths of light to advertise healing and reduce pain.

This ingenious strategy targets damaged tissues, boosting mobile task without causing harm or discomfort. You may discover it beneficial for numerous conditions, including joint discomfort, muscle mass injuries, and inflammation.

Unlike standard laser therapies, cold laser treatment does not create warmth, making it risk-free and comfortable for clients. Treatments normally last between 5 to thirty minutes, depending upon the location being resolved.

You might receive several sessions for optimum outcomes, and lots of people report feeling alleviation after just a few treatments.

Cold laser treatment offers a promising choice for those looking for effective discomfort administration.

System of Action



Laser treatment employs low-level lasers or light-emitting diodes to stimulate cellular processes. When you get treatment, the light penetrates your skin and is taken in by your cells, particularly the mitochondria. This absorption enhances ATP manufacturing, which is the power money of your cells. Consequently, your cells can fix themselves quicker and successfully.

Additionally, cold laser therapy advertises raised blood circulation, delivering even more oxygen and nutrients to damaged cells. It also helps in reducing swelling and discomfort by modulating the release of numerous biochemical compounds.

Therapy Process Summary



When you go through cold laser treatment, a qualified practitioner routes low-level laser light onto the targeted area of your body. This non-invasive procedure generally lasts in between 15 to 30 minutes, depending on your problem and the location being dealt with. You might really feel a mild warmth or prickling feeling, yet the process is typically painless.


The laser light penetrates your skin, boosting mobile task and advertising healing. Sessions are usually scheduled several times a week for optimum results, and you could observe improvements after just a few treatments.

After each session, you can usually resume your daily activities without any downtime, making it a practical alternative for those looking for remedy for pain or swelling.

Safety and Negative Effects of Cold Laser Treatment



While cold laser therapy is typically considered risk-free, it's important to be aware of possible adverse effects. Most people experience marginal discomfort, but you may see momentary skin irritation or a sensation of heat during treatment.

Seldom, some people report migraines or lightheadedness after sessions. If you're sensitive to light or have particular medical conditions, review this with your doctor before beginning treatment.

Likewise, make sure the professional is qualified and utilizes FDA-approved equipment. Although major side effects are unusual, it's wise to check your body's action after each session.

If you experience any uncommon signs and symptoms, do not think twice to reach out to your medical professional for support. Being educated aids make sure a favorable experience with cold laser treatment.
